Microsoft Teams
Microsoft Teams is a comprehensive platform for chatting, working together, and holding video conferences, designed to be a universal solution suitable for teams of any scale. She has become a primary component of the Microsoft 365 ecosystem, bringing together communication and collaboration featuresâmessaging, calls, meetings, files, and integrationsâin one environment. The central idea of Teams is to offer users a single digital hub for all their needs, where all communication, task planning, meetings, and document editing happen without leaving the app.
Microsoft Publisher
Microsoft Publisher offers an intuitive and affordable desktop publishing experience, aimed at producing high-quality printed and digital content avoid using sophisticated graphic software. Unlike standard document editors, publisher offers expanded options for exact element placement and design editing. The software includes a broad collection of ready templates and adjustable layout configurations, that facilitate rapid onboarding for users without design experience.

Microsoft OneNote
Microsoft OneNote is a digital notebook application aimed at quick and efficient collection, storage, and management of ideas, notes, and thoughts. It fuses the traditional feel of a notebook with the technological advantages of modern software: this space allows you to write text, upload images, audio files, links, and tables. OneNote is great for personal notes, as well as for studying, work, and collaborative projects. Thanks to the Microsoft 365 cloud service, all data is synchronized automatically between devices, delivering data access wherever and whenever needed, whether on a computer, tablet, or smartphone.
